How do tube lights work?

Fluorescent lamps work by ionizing mercury vapor in a glass tube. This causes electrons in the gas to emit photons at UV frequencies. The UV light is converted into standard visible light using a phosphor coating on the inside of the tube.

Why does Tubelight glow?

A fluorescent lamp, or fluorescent tube, is a low-pressure mercury-vapor gas-discharge lamp that uses fluorescence to produce visible light. An electric current in the gas excites mercury vapor, which produces short-wave ultraviolet light that then causes a phosphor coating on the inside of the lamp to glow.

Can we start the tube light without a starter?

When you turn on a fluorescent tube, the starter is a closed switch. The filaments at the ends of the tube are heated by electricity, and they create a cloud of electrons inside the tube. Without the starter, a steady stream of electrons is never created between the two filaments, and the lamp flickers.

What are the different types of tube lights?

Types of Tube Light Bulbs. While there are multiple types of LED and fluorescent tube lights, the three most common are T12, T8 and T5. The terminology comes from “T” for “tubular” and the diameter of the bulb in eighths of an inch, so “T8” represents a tube of 8/8ths of an inch, or 1 inch.

What kind of light is a T8 tube?

What does T8 tube light mean? A T8 tube light is a 1 inch diameter fluorescent or LED tube of varying lengths with a bi-pin or single pin base. T8 tube lights are commonly used in high bay fixtures, troffers, and other general lighting applications. Can a T8 LED replace a T12? Yes, a T8 can replace a T12 bulb of the same length and wattage.
